Abstract
A monitor stop system is disclosed. The system may include a top-tilting monitor. The system may also include a monitor shroud including a tab configured to prevent the monitor from actuating to the deployed position during an HIC event. The system may further include one or more monitor stop devices. Each monitor stop device may include a spring-loaded pin assembly and a housing configured to surround at least a portion of the spring-loaded assembly. The tab may be configured to translate towards an interior surface of the seatback bezel and may be configured to cause the pin to translate through one or more monitor stop openings of the seatback bezel. Upon the pin translating, the pin may be configured to capture at least a portion of the top-tilting monitor to prevent the top-tilting monitor from actuating to the deployed position during the HIC event.
